Regulation is crucial for Romania traders, as it ensures fund safety and fair practices. Tickmill is regulated by top-tier authorities including the FCA (UK) and CySEC (Cyprus), while Trade Nation is regulated by the FCA and ASIC (Australia). Neither broker is directly regulated by ASF Romania, but both comply with EU financial regulations (MiFID II) when serving Romanian clients. This means Romania traders benefit from negative balance protection, segregated client funds, and access to investor compensation schemes (up to €20,000 under CySEC). Trade Nation’s FCA regulation provides similar protections. Romania traders should verify the specific entity they open an account with, as regulatory coverage may vary. Overall, both brokers offer strong regulatory safeguards, with Tickmill having a slight edge due to its multiple licenses.

Romania traders can fund their accounts using Bank Transfer, Credit Card, and Skrill with both Tickmill and Trade Nation. Tickmill supports instant deposits via Credit Card and Skrill with no fees, and withdrawals are also free, processed within 24 hours. Bank Transfer deposits take 1-3 business days and may incur intermediary bank fees. Trade Nation also offers free deposits via Credit Card and Skrill, but withdrawals via these methods may incur a small fee (e.g., $5 for Skrill). Bank Transfer withdrawals are free with Trade Nation. For Romania traders, Skrill is a popular e-wallet due to its speed and low costs. Tickmill’s fee-free withdrawal policy gives it an advantage for active traders, while Trade Nation’s fee on e-wallet withdrawals may be a minor drawback. Both brokers support RON deposits via Bank Transfer, but conversion to USD/EUR applies.
